Director, Payments Product Management – Denver, CO & Austin, TX

Are you passionate about Product Management in FinTech? Do you have experience delivering payments products that delight consumers and add business value? Are you ready to build and lead a global team focused on creating industry-leading payments experiences? If you have a track record of driving product delivery, applying user-centric design practices to the creative process of ideating on new products that solve customer needs and have a robust knowledge of the payments landscape, then it's time to join Western Union's Payments Product team as Director, Payments Product Management.

Role Responsibilities

  • Define the product strategy and roadmap for a set of payments capabilities.
  • Work with Western Union senior leadership and cross-functional regional leaders for products and ideas on forward-looking Fintech and money movement products.
  • Work with front-end teams to launch new and enhance existing payments capabilities that will improve our end-to-end customer experience.
  • Be experienced in both upstream product and service definition, and downstream product development and execution.
  • Think strategically and creatively to gather product and process insights from customers and key internal/external stakeholders.
  • Propose solutions that promote organizational key performance indicators and follow-up with analytics teams to measure success.
  • Understand product alternatives and work with a multi-disciplined team to understand trade-offs and put value on alternatives.
  • Partner closely with engineers, operations, product marketing, sales, customer success, risk, and finance to ensure our clients are at the center of everything we build.
  • Own and prioritize a roadmap to balance both exploring new product enhancements and existing product optimizations.
  • Manage products through the product development lifecycle ensuring that proper alignment and approvals are obtained from Legal, Compliance, Privacy, and Infosec.
  • Provide ongoing analysis on product effectiveness using a data-driven approach.
  • Coordinate with our global operations and marketing teams to ensure a successful GTM execution.
  • Act as a people leader and build a high-quality and high-performing team.
  • Data-driven product management and ownership of product KPIs and OKRs across the entire customer engagement journey.
  • Build trust and influence across teams, stakeholders, and the global organization.
  • Role Requirements

  • Previous working experience as a Product Manager 10+ years (Financial Services a plus).
  • Proven track record of leading the development and implementation of successful product strategies with excellent cross-functional leadership skills.
  • Strong collaboration skills, able to build trust and negotiate with teams across different seniority levels and functions.
  • Strong background in building high-performing teams and developing diverse talent.
  • Experience in building FinTech products for omnichannel customers (retail and digital) preferred.
  • Strong business writing, numerical analysis, presentation, and verbal communication skills.
  • Get things done attitude; self-motivated with the ability to prioritize critical deadlines.
  • Experience working with multiple stakeholders/teams in different countries with different cultural backgrounds.
  • Previous experience of lean and agile working methodologies.
  • Team player with the ability to prioritize workload in line with tight deadlines and under pressure.
  • SalaryThe on-target earnings range is $211,756 – $282,531 per year, which includes a base salary, short-term and long-term incentives that align with individual and company performance.
